Selaginella moellendorffii

polypeptide: 102878

ID: 102878.v1.91
Display: K13120 - protein FAM32A (FAM32A) (1 of 1)
Orthologous Group: OG0002737

Mrna: 102878.v1.91 K13120 - protein FAM32A (FAM32A) (1 of 1)